Election History
| Year | General Election | Votes Polled | Seats Won |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1996 | 11th Tamil Nadu Assembly | 2,526,474 | 39 |
| 1996 | 11th Lok Sabha | 7,339,982 | 20 |
| 1998 | 12th Lok Sabha | 5,169,183 | 3 |
| 1999 | 13th Lok Sabha | 2,946,899 | 0 |
| 2001 | 12th Tamil Nadu Assembly | 1,885,726 | 23 |
